Output 51b168af6e83de536842661fd7dfab25840974d401d5175d5e26cf92d0481d0b:1

value
537345513
script pubkey
OP_0 OP_PUSHBYTES_20 ffaf9df6c2ba123b6da842e5b8aaca8fe943bd5d
address
ltc1ql7hemakzhgfrkmdggtjm32k23l55802ajx7qwl
transaction
51b168af6e83de536842661fd7dfab25840974d401d5175d5e26cf92d0481d0b
spent
true